    Acetaldehyde and ethanol appear in the headspace above a fermenting yeast/glucose/water mexture in a sealed glass bottle at a temperature of 30°C. A fixed quantity of yeast (10mg) and varying amounts (2 to 16mg) of both non-deuterated glucose and glucose-6,6-d2 in 5 ml of water were used. The ethanol and acetaldehyde concentrations in the headspace were obtained from the magnitudes of their characteristic ions on the accumulated SIFT-MS spectra and when the deuterated glucose was used.
